Before buying a refrigerator, measure the area where you'll be installing it. Make sure that there is an easy access to your fridge and that nothing will get in the way of opening the doors. It is also important to determine whether you want a single-door or French-door refrigerator and what style of handles you prefer, such as ones that swing open on both sides or ones that only open on one side.

4. LG Door-in-Door Refrigerator

The LG Door-in Door refrigerator is a great alternative for those who want an appliance that can make an impact in their kitchen. This innovative design puts the smaller section of your refrigerator with an opening so that you can easily access frequently needed items without having to open the entire fridge. The refrigerator that is door-indoor keeps cold air in and helps keep your food fresher for longer.

LG Refrigerators with InstaView door-in-door comes in several different designs, but the most common is a black stainless steel finish that is incredibly easy-to-clean. Some models come with a coating that is resistant to fingerprints that makes it simple to wipe off any smudges or spills.

LG invented the concept of a door-indoor fridge in 2014. It is now available in different sizes and styles. The most recent models are available in counter-depth designs that stick out about 6 inches from your countertop, as well as standard depth designs that sit about 30 to 34 inches tall.
